What We’re Looking For:

We’re searching for a passionate and experienced leader who isn’t afraid to go the extra mile. You should be someone who can inspire and motivate our team to deliver the highest quality care and educational experiences for the children in our care. Your leadership will be pivotal in ensuring that each child receives the best possible start in life.

  • Lead, motivate, and support a dedicated team of nursery staff.
  • Foster a positive, collaborative working environment where every team member feels valued and supported.
  • Manage recruitment, onboarding, and staff training to maintain a high-quality workforce.
  • Oversee staff performance, conduct regular appraisals, and provide ongoing development opportunities.
  • Ensure effective communication within the team, encouraging feedback, ideas, and a team-oriented culture.
  • Ensure the nursery provides a safe, stimulating, and nurturing environment for all children.
  • Oversee the planning and delivery of the curriculum, ensuring it meets the individual needs of each child.
  • Monitor and support children’s development, tracking progress and addressing any areas of concern.
  • Promote the wellbeing, safety, and emotional development of the children.
  • Ensure compliance with safeguarding procedures and policies to protect the children at all times.
  • Oversee the nursery’s budget, ensuring efficient use of resources and managing costs effectively.
  • Monitor and report on the nursery’s financial performance, ensuring targets are met.
  • Manage daily operations, including attendance records, health and safety checks, and compliance with regulatory requirements.
  • Ensure the nursery is well-equipped with resources, supplies, and educational materials.
